Description of corpora
Serbian
Description
- The word list was designed by Milica Radišić to illustrate various consonants and vowels of the language; it was partially based on Landau et al. (1995)'s JIPA Illustration of IPA 'Croatian' (adapted for Serbian), with additional sentences added to illustrate the contrasts in laterals, nasals, and affricates across word positions and vowel contexts.
- The data are from 4 speakers, two of whom are from Niš and two from Novi Sad.
- The simultaneous EPG and audio recordings were collected in the Linguistics Phonetics Lab in 2008-10.
Speaker codes
- SRf01, SRm01, SRf02, SRf03
Materials
- Single words (alphabetical)
- Short sentences (alphabetical)
- On average 6 repetitions of the words were elicited.
- In file names, 'c' refers to short sentences and 's' to words in isolation (e.g. duga_s1_epSRf01: the first repetition of the word 'duga' in isolation by SRf01).
- (The Serbian files have not yet been coded for segments/graphemes.)
